About this listen

Life begins at 40 - but so do bad joints, wrinkles, and gray hairs.

They say that by the age of 40 you should have gained the skills and experience to have a better life.

But the only thing I've gained is a job promotion to permanent desk jockey until retirement. I thought I escaped my mediocre destiny when I met my husband...until he died on our honeymoon and a series of unfortunate events left me with a strange mark on my body and my husband's corpse stolen right out of the funeral home!

When I discover a mysterious invitation to a place called the Vale Estates at my door from a long-lost grandmother I had never met. I was ready to toss it away as a scam until I read the words: Your husband's death was not an accident. Desperate for answers, I pack up and go.

But to discover the truth, I'm forced to live in a bizarre estate full of restless ghosts and a creepy goat-legged caretaker while enduring a trial of magic with death as a punishment for failure.

But I'm not a mage! Or at least, I thought.

I guess it's not too late to learn something new.
